Rotigotine has an average rating of 7.7 out of 10 from a total of 75 reviews on Drugs.com. 69% of reviewers reported a positive experience, while 12% reported a negative experience.

Rotigotine for Restless Legs Syndrome "Use the 1 mg patch, which I put on my thigh 3 hours before I go to bed. I leave it on only until 2 or 3 AM and then I take it off. That means it is only on about 7 or 8 hours per night. It stops the RLS completely and reduces any unwanted side effects and rashes. I was only getting the RLS about a half hour after going to bed, so I felt that I didn't have to wear the patch all day if I only have the RLS at night. I make sure that my skin is very clean and dry before putting the patch on. I noticed that I still get RLS at night if I eat things with MSG like Chinese food, so it doesn't do anything for that. But otherwise it has worked great. Hopefully just using the patch for a relatively short time each night will reduce any chance of augmentation or any other problems."
